Minimum Wages in Rajasthan: Rates for All Worker Categories

The Rajasthan State Government has revised the minimum wages for workers. The minimum wage is calculated by adding the basic wage and Variable Dearness Allowance (VDA). 

The minimum wages are fixed based on the skill level of the worker. The categories are divided into:

    • Unskilled workers: Watchmen, welders, work keepers, creche attendants, watermen, petrol loaders, pump operators, crater men, gangmen, wool washers, etc.
    • Semi-skilled workers:Assistant carpenters, semi-skilled clerks, land surveyors, creche-in-charge, wiremen, head dealers, assistant turners, assistant operators, stone dressers and cutters, tyre fitters, lift operators, pipers, etc.
    • Skilled workers: Masons, tailors, tanners, painters, mechanics, fitters, blacksmiths, carpenters, linemen, plumbers, library clerks, typists, cashiers, etc.
    • Highly skilled workers: Chemists, medical representatives, pharmacists, lab technicians, etc.

The following table shows the minimum wages for scheduled employment in Rajasthan:

Worker CategoryMinimum Wages Per DayMinimum Wages Per Month
Unskilled₹285₹7,410
Semi-Skilled₹297<₹7,722
Skilled₹309₹8,034
Highly Skilled₹359<₹9,334
